About this work

This painting shows a woman's head in profile, facing right. She has red hair pulled back and covered with a white veil. Her skin is pale, and she wears a green dress with gold and red patterns on the shoulder. A white cloth is draped around her neck, and she has multiple strands of pearls around it. The woman's attire and accessories suggest a sense of elegance and refinement. The use of pearls and intricate patterns on her clothing adds to the overall sense of luxury and sophistication.
